Output 5860c5876e02af0918e9cbb27de4929327be43cfe0e4f146c7e5ea32e99fb5be:6

value
231005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bae9a2f9949962a8cf4383715beebfff2712048 OP_EQUAL
address
3Mib58k7ZvbF1p2RVcPej9iAi6h3v8RJEd
transaction
5860c5876e02af0918e9cbb27de4929327be43cfe0e4f146c7e5ea32e99fb5be
spent
true